Puma Suede Mayu White/Black (380686-02)

De Mayu is een update van een klassieker met toekomstbestendige ontwerpdetails en is een stap vooruit in streetwear. De gewaagde platformzool speelt met de iconische proporties van de legendarische Suede-stijl en zorgt voor een gedurfde look die elke dag gedragen kan worden. Natuurlijk zijn ze cool en comfortabel, maar het bovenwerk van premium suède en het PUMA-logo in folieprint maken ze extra bijzonder. Tijdloos voor vandaag.

FEATURES and BENEFITS CMEVA: PUMA’s drukgevormde EVA-materiaal voor lichtgewicht performance Laag model Bovenwerk van suède EVA-tussenzool Rubberen zool PUMA Formstrip op de zijkant PUMA No. 2-logo in reliëf en folieprint op de schacht en hielcap Geweven PUMA Archive No. 1-label in zeefdruk op de tong. Price distribution Puma Suede

We compare this sneaker's price with the 500 other adult versions of the Puma Suede that we track. At a lowest price of €71 this colorway is cheaper than 75% of those 500 versions. The group median sits at €103, with resale outliers up to €3.189. The chart shows exactly where this sneaker falls — the black marker — among all the others.

CheapestPuma Suede Mayu Slip On TeddyWMNS (beige) – 384887-02€21PriciestPuma Liga Suede Classic Retro “Limestone Grey / Black” (341466-71)€3.189

We always compare the lowest price a colorway is currently on sale for somewhere: the cheapest entry point, usually for one specific size. The comparison stays within the same age group, because a kids size (TD/PS/GS) is priced differently than an adult size. Because the price varies per size, your size may come out a little higher. To keep the comparison fair we leave out the most and least expensive two percent — the resale outliers, and the price axis is logarithmic so both the cheap and the pricey end stay readable.
